Output db727929c9383dc3eea1a10010b55fbe4e4a436ad73c5455e24dfeb17742c80e:36

value
2354596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 223f3779e3fb0d9e168e431743d2f53604756c3b OP_EQUAL
address
34p6dSSwLvYRcshoFi9QNbb74vwEpW8qH4
transaction
db727929c9383dc3eea1a10010b55fbe4e4a436ad73c5455e24dfeb17742c80e